Cebuana marathoner Mary Joy Tabal earned Philippines’ first gold at the on-going South East Asian Games 2017 in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ia. She won the 42K Marathon in 2 hours, 43 minutes and 31 seconds, well ahead of her competitors, Hong Thi Tanh of Vietnam and Natthaya Thanaronnwat of Thailand who were awarded silver and bronze respectively.

She broke down in tears at the finish line. She said “ Tears of joy talaga. Yung feeling ko na lahat ng pinagdaanan ko, yung hirap, yung training, yung sacrifices ko, parang nagbunga siyang lahat. Despite of the fact I was a little pressured to realy deliver a good performance”, she told Rappler.

It was Phillipine Amateur Track and Field Association (PATAFA) president Philip Ella Juico who assisted her after crossing the finish line, recognizing her of the talents and hard work and sacrifice in winning this prestigious event.

“We congratulate Mary Joy Tabal for giving the Philippines its first gold medal with her performance in the women’s marathon at the 2017 Southeast Asian Games in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ia,” Malacañang said in a statement read by China Jocson, assistant to the Presidential Spokesperson, on state-run Radyo Pilipinas on Saturday.
“Congratulations to our athletes and good luck to the rest of the Philippine team. The whole nation is solidly behind you. Mabuhay po kayo!” the Palace continued.
